Footy Day – 2014

Yesterday was footy day. People had to dress up in their footy clothes. I barrack for hawthorn so I wore a hawthorn jumper. When the bell rang at 9:00am the whole school had a footy parade, we listened to each footy team’s anthem and if you went for them you had to get up and go around the circle while you’re anthem is playing.
After recess we had all types of different footy activities with Strathmore Secondary Collage. We got put into groups my group was 3.The first activity our group did was hand balling. The main idea for hand balling was to try and get the target (which was 10 points). We missed out on one activity that activity was doing hurdling and then get a footy bouncing it or tapping the footy on the floor. For lunch some people ordered hot dogs and a juice box. I ordered 2 hot dogs and 1 juice boxes. At lunch time we played marches up.

Sports report 28/03/2014

Today the girls’ basketball team played a tense and tiring game against St Fidelis. The scores were 14-4 in our favour. Some of the highlights were Gisg’s stealing, Emey’s shooting, Chlop’s rebounding and everyone’s passing. The team is still undefeated. I would like to thank Mr M for coaching us and Mrs B for umpiring.

book report

I am reading a book called EJ12 Girl Hero. It is about a girl who
is a spy and she goes on spy missions. My favourite part is when Emma goes into spy HQ. She goes into the spy HQ by going into the last toilet cubicle in the girls toilets, puts a micro chip from her phone into the toilet paper roll, puts in a code on her phone and then the wall turns around to the HQ. I have enjoyed reading this book.
